Elements Contributing to the Scene’s Impact

Several factors come into play when dissecting the effectiveness of the John Wick Reloading Scene:

  • Choreography: Each movement is expertly choreographed, creating a fluid and believable sequence.
  • Cinematography: Camera angles enhance the action, capturing each detail of the reloading process.
  • Sound Design: The sounds of the bullets and the gun mechanism add a layer of realism and intensity.
  • Character Depth: This scene reflects John Wick’s discipline and precision, revealing his background as an assassin.

The Role of Reloading in Action Sequences

Reloading is often overlooked in favor of rapid-fire shooting in action films, but in John Wick, it becomes a pivotal moment. It allows for character reflection and a pause in the relentless action that heightens suspense. This moment lends itself to strategic thinking in an environment where every second counts.
